Title :
Using graph matching to compare VHR satellite images with GIS data

Abstract :
We propose a graph matching methodology based on relaxation labeling to compare road junction in VHR satellite images with GIS road data. Use is made of the spatial layout between points based on the relative angle. The technique finds correspondences between set of points taking into account error on the spatial location and spurious or missing points. An analysis is given to determine the weights of the algorithm based on the expected graph error.
